Flickering Panel and Instrument Lighting

Featured Replies

Howdy. Just began in the last few weeks. The symptoms (multiple planes) are when dash lights (panel/instrument) are enabled they turn on as normal but soon they start flickering and flashing as if they had a short.  No rhyme or reason. Not every time but most.  I had a couple of lighting enhancements I bought on MP, runway and landing lights. I’ve disabled both in case it’s related but the issue remains.

Anyone else seeing this or has seen?  I’m stumped!

This is a known issue when encountering a significant amount of injected AI traffic, and is repeatable. (Example: Inject a ton of AIG traffic around areas like New York City). I can't remember the technical terminology that was the real root cause from a programming perspective, but the light malfunctions were tied to AI. Guessing there may be a limit as to light sources that can be displayed at one time in the sim.

Brillient problem identification.  This has been seen by some users in the Hjet.  The Hjet, like its namesake the Hondajet, automates the lights to a large extent, recognizing you are starting the engines and thus illuminating the beacon.  Turning on the taxi lights when you start moving.  Even turning on landing lights when you enter or cross a runway. Users have found that a light switch position on their controls that is in the opposite position from the automatic behaviour in the sim aircraft can cause a continuous loop of on/off/on/off/on/off.........   reaction from the sim and the conflicting controls assignment(s).  The same can occur when the switch position in other aircraft in the sim do not match the switch assignment for a controller.

I recommend cleaning up the controls settings for lights, even perhaps clearing them all to not-assigned.  See if that resolves the issue. Then start over with assignments, one by one.
